Default I have never told this but Hannah's

story makes me think I will. I had the world's most wonderful pionus once. His name was Max. It was Dec. 23 and we were going to a X'mas party. I was late as usual and since it was 75 degrees here in Houston, Max was on the patio in his cage. I was frantically getting ready for the party and my sweet hubby thought he would help me save time by bringing Max inside. He never held him. Max got scared and flew off. Luke hollered at me at Max was hanging on the side of the house. When I got to him with a ladder he flew away. I remember thinking "O how beautiful he is". I have never seen him again. I searched for 2 months. One lady stopped her car one day and asked if I was ok. I was in a field (raining) and was singing "High on a hill was a lonely goatherd...(yodel yodel, etc.)" from the Sound of Music. It was our song. Oh the heartbreak! Still.
